WARNING TO SERVICE PERSONNEL: Microwave ovens con-
tain circuitry capable of producing very high voltage and
current, contact with following parts may result in a severe,
possibly fatal, electrical shock. (High Voltage Capacitor, High
Voltage Power Transformer, Magnetron, High Voltage Recti-
fier Assembly, High Voltage Harness etc..)

  • Page 13 R-410FK R-410FW TEST PROCEDURES PROCEDURE COMPONENT TEST LETTER 4. To test for an open filament, isolate the magnetron from the high voltage circuit. A continuity check across the magnetron filament leads should indicate less than 1 ohm. 5. To test for a shorted magnetron, connect the ohmmeter leads between the magnetron filament leads and chassis ground.

    R - 4 1 0 F K R-410FW TOUCH CONTROL PANEL ASSEMBLY OUTLINE OF TOUCH CONTROL PANEL The touch control section consists of the following units. This circuit consists of 22 segments and 3 common electrodes using a Liquid Crystal Display.
  • Page 21 R-410FK DESCRIPTION OF LSI R-410FW The I/O signal of the LSI is detailed in the following table. Pin No. Signal Description VL2-VL1 Power source voltage input terminal. Standard voltage for LCD. AN7-AN4 Terminal to change cooking input according to the Model.
  • Page 22 R - 4 1 0 F K R-410FW Pin No. Signal Description RESET Auto clear terminal. Signal is input to reset the LSI to the initial state when power is applied. Temporarily set “L” level the moment power is applied, at this time the LSI is reset. Thereafter set at “H”...
  • Page 23 R-410FK R-410FW Pin No. Signal Description 73/74 Connected to GND. VCC/VREF AVSS Connected to VC. COM3 Terminal not used. COM2 Common data signal. Connected to LCD signal COM3. COM1 Common data signal. Connected to LCD signal COM2. COM0 Common data signal.
